KARACHI: Aligarh body elects office-bearers



By Our Staff Reporter


KARACHI, Sept 28: The chancellor of the Sir Syed University, Z.A. Nizami, has been elected president of the Aligarh Muslim University Old Boys Association for the third consecutive term, says a press release.

The results of the elections, held on Saturday, were announced on Sunday. Mr Nizami got 194 votes, and his opponent 50.

Engr Zakir Ali Khan was elected general-secretary for the fifth consecutive term. He secured 214 votes.

Other office-bearers elected were Mohammad Afzal Hanif as honorary treasurer; Asghar Ali honorary general-secretary, Ali Zafar Khan Afridi joint secretary (sports), Syed Arif Raza joint secretary (publicity) and Absar Ahmed Siddiqui joint secretary (academic).

The 18-member executive committee elected. The winners were Abdul Rasheed Khan, Abdul Sattar Khan, Mohammad Hussain, Sultan-ul-Arifeen, Mohammad Saleem Saleh, Syed Mahmood Hussain Zaidi, M.A. Yazdani, Yusuf Siddiqui, Waheeduzzaman Ansari, Mukhtar Ahmed Naqvi, Sharaf Ali Hashmi, Commander I.R. Farooqi, S. Faiq Hussain, Mohammad Moudood Ansari, Syed Aftab Ahmed Zaidi, Commander Saleem Siddiqui, Mazhar Ali Khan Arif and Mohammad Zafar Hasnain.
